Finally, Some Guidance! Using the Triple E Framework to Shape Technology Integration
Gaer, Susan; Reyes, Kristi
Adult Literacy Education, v4 n3 p34-40 Fall 2022
How can schools integrate the lessons of remote learning during the COVID-19 pandemic into their face-to-face teaching. What guidelines can teachers use to be sure they are integrating technology? In this article, we propose an adaptation of the Triple E Framework to guide this work. The goal of the framework is to ensure that technology use supports student engagement, and then, while engaged, students' learning is enhanced and extended by technology.
